|
|
@ -321,10 +321,10 @@ public class IcServiceRecordV2ServiceImpl extends BaseServiceImpl<IcServiceRecor |
|
|
|
if (eOrgIdPath.contains(so.getOrgIdPath())) { |
|
|
|
// 说明这条数据,是这个子级组织下的数据
|
|
|
|
so.setServeTimes(so.getServeTimes() + e.getServeTimes()); |
|
|
|
so.setCompletedTimes(so.getCompletedTimes() + e.getCompletedTimes()); |
|
|
|
so.setFeedbackTimes(so.getFeedbackTimes() + e.getFeedbackTimes()); |
|
|
|
so.setSatisfactionTimes(so.getSatisfactionTimes() + e.getSatisfactionTimes()); |
|
|
|
|
|
|
|
double satisfactionRate = so.getSatisfactionTimes() * 100.0 / so.getCompletedTimes(); |
|
|
|
double satisfactionRate = so.getSatisfactionTimes() * 100.0 / so.getFeedbackTimes(); |
|
|
|
so.setSatisfactionRate(new BigDecimal(satisfactionRate).setScale(2, BigDecimal.ROUND_HALF_UP)); |
|
|
|
} |
|
|
|
} |
|
|
|